The Chinese giant has unveiled its new electric SUV the size of a Peugeot 408. And it’s safe to say that the threat is significant.
Beyond Your Dreams. Beyond your dreams, in French. Remember these three letters, which sound amusing when pronounced “in a French way.” But for now, BYD seems to be protecting itself from failure given the huge investments made to succeed in its gamble: conquering the whole planet. And Europe is high on its shopping list… This giant has just surpassed 5 million electric cars produced, and in China, it is by far the leading seller of decarbonized vehicles, with sales three times higher than Tesla’s. Finally, BYD is the global leader in electric buses. Many units are already traveling through major French cities.

With its Song L SUV equipped with four-wheel drive, and scheduled for immediate release (first deliveries in Q4 2023). Its design inspiration is multiple: some elements from Audi, Porsche, Lamborghini or Cupra as well. A touch of Lexus also in the look. In any case, the overall appearance is very aggressive and dynamic. The driving experience will be similarly lively with active chassis control and a combined power of 390 kW (530 hp). Lastly, the “certified” range is about 600 km.

Inside, BYD promises a ultra-modern, minimalist cockpit, reminiscent of Tesla’s style. Finally, the local price is around $29,900, approximately €25,000. Considering European tolls, the final price is estimated close to €35,000.
